Scotland Day 3 - Success at last!

After the nights snoring competition we all seemed to drift into the kitchen at around 05:30 - 06:00 for a cuppa, seems none of us had a great nights sleep.  Nevertheless come 07:00 we were on the road and heading to Chanonry Point.  We arrived in good time, just as two ladies that had been watching for Dolphins gave up and wandered off, that filled us full of confidence.

Wobbly shot of a pair of Dolphins, one with its head out.
Stayed put though, and after a while a single Dolphin obliged and came and entertained us, and then another and a couple more.  It soon became clear that all they were going to show us was backs and tails, not very good, I managed a shaky shot of a pair where one had its head out of the water, but if they don't jump out its more of an actual spectacle than a photographic one! 

After that and a Scottish breakfast, we headed to Cromarty and saw oil rigs parked in the bay, and a pair of Mergansers.
Male Merganser, last one I saw was in Iceland
From there it was a quick dash off to the Cairn Gorm Muntain Railway at Aviemore, where incredibly, in Mid May they still have a prepared Piste and it was quite busy for Skiers and Boarders, of course that messed up our trek to the top but we're getting used to disappointment now.

Skiing on May 21st 2012 at Aviemore.

A swift coffee at the restaurant, a few pics and down again.  This time off to a secret place to take pictures of an extremely rare bird, the Capercaillie.




Final stop of the day, Kincraig to see a pair of Ospreys nesting and take a few photos.  Sadly the sun was behind them so we only really had silhouettes to work with, think we may be back tomorrow morning.

Topped the day of with Haggis and chips, and a couple of Bellhavens!

A better day by far.
